William Rogers Obituary

Groton - William Stephen "Bill" Rogers Jr., 95, died Dec. 17, 2022, at Complete Care at the Groton Regency. Bill was born April 21, 1927, in Newport, R.I., to the late William and Mary Rogers. He eventually moved to New London where he met and married his wife of 56 years, Marion Dorsey Rogers. He resided in New London until Marion's passing, when he moved to Solstice Senior Living and ultimately Groton Regency Retirement communities in Groton.

He is survived by his sister Ann Sullivan of Hilton Head Island, S.C.; son Stephen Rogers of Waterford; daughter Paula Reynolds of Manchester; son Phillip Rogers and his wife Lynn of Bluffton, S.C.; grandchildren, Laura Reynolds of East Hartford, Robert Reynolds of Uncasville, Ashley Shasha and husband Mark Emilyta; and great-granddaughter Makenzie Emilyta. He was predeceased by his wife Marion; and his sister Barbara Zitolli.

Bill had an affinity for numbers and ultimately received a degree in accounting from Mitchell College. He spent most of his accounting career at Doherty, Beals, & Banks, P.C. in New London. He was an avid fan of the Boston Red Sox, Notre Dame football and the Miami Dolphins.

The family wishes to thank the staff at Groton Regency and the team at Beacon Hospice for the care and compassion shown toward Bill.

A Mass of Christian Burial will be held at 10 a.m. Wednesday, Dec. 21, at St. Joseph's Church, 17 Squire Street, New London. Interment will be private. In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to St. Joseph's Church.
